国际生态学研究发展态势文献计量分析

A bibliometrical analysis of competitive situation in international ecological research

摘要

Abstract

Nowadays, ecological and environmental problems have attracted much attention of governments and people, because ecological research can provide the theoretical basis and guideline for the coexistence between humans and the natural ecosystem.In this paper, analytical tools such as Thomson Data Analyzer, NetDraw and Aureka in combined with “pathfinder” algorithm were used to analyze the data of ecological research in the SCIE and SSCI databases.We find that the papers of the Northern America, Europe,Australia and their institutions have stronger impact on international ecological research and their quality is better.Meanwhile, the United States is the international center of the cooperative research web in ecology, followed by the United Kingdom and Germany.At institutional level, University of California Davis and Max Planck Institute are two distinctive centers for cooperative research in ecology.The numbers of papers on ecological research in China is ranked the eleventh, but the quality of the papers is still low.The main countries in collaboration with China include the United States, the United Kingdom, Canada, Germany, Japan, Australia and France in ecological research.In the years from from 2008 to 2010, the hot spots of international ecology are mainly focused on biodiversity, climate change, gene variation, interactions among species and sexual selection, etc.
